Webv. pushed, push·ing, push·es. v.tr. 1. a. To apply pressure against (something), especially for the purpose of moving it: pushed the door but couldn't budge it. b. To move (something) by exerting force against it; thrust or shove: pushed the crate aside. c. To exert downward pressure on (a button or keyboard, for example); press.
